The Diabetes Association of Greater Cleveland's Dietrich Diabetes Research Institute DDRI Summer Internship in Diabetes Research is a unique summer research opportunity designed to give college students (undergraduate, graduate and medical students) first-hand experience in diabetes research. The program offers up to six students the opportunity to work for a ten-week period (June-August) with established diabetes researchers in northeast Ohio's premier medical institutions. DDRI’s Summer Internship in Diabetes Research is often a student’s first exposure to diabetes research with the hope of fostering a continuing interest in the field of diabetes.
Each intern is sponsored by a local diabetes researcher and works closely with his or her sponsor designing and completing a research project in the area of diabetes during the 10-week internship. In addition, interns receive a $2,500 award (payable through the sponsor's institution), attend weekly diabetes seminars, spend time at Camp Ho Mita Koda, and present their research projects at a DDRI Quarterly Meeting. The Summer Internship in Diabetes Research began in 1986 as the Andrea Vigliotti Summer Research Internship. It is the first summer research internship in the country pairing undergraduates with established researchers and the oldest diabetes research program in the country connecting undergraduate, graduate, and medical students with local diabetes investigators for summer research. Through 2007, $198,000 has been awarded to 100 exceptional students working with 63 different sponsors.
